0

我已经下载了 OpenNETCF 的智能设备框架,但两者都

OpenNETCF.Net.NetworkInformation.Adapter

OpenNETCF.Net.NetworkInformation.AdapterCollection

产生一个

来自编译器的“命名空间丢失或不可用”错误。

我正在使用 OpenNetCF.Net 版本 2.3.1.12004.0

4

2 回答 2

0

在我清理大量冗余之前,这些来自旧的 1.4 版本。你想要的是这样的:

var adapters = OpenNETCF.Net.NetworkInformation.NetworkInterface.GetAllNetworkInterfaces()
于 2012-09-20T13:35:55.313 回答
0

Adapter 和 AdaptorCollection 类是 Opennetcf.net 的旧版本。

较新的版本包含 AccessPoint 和 AccessPointCollection。

但是,您可以像这样使用适配器,

INetworkInterface[] nics = NetworkInterface.GetAllNetworkInterfaces();

然后,您可以根据using OpenNETCF.Net.NetworkInformation;网络接口的类型对 nics 进行类型化,例如 wirelessNetworkInterface、wirelessZeroConfiguredNetworkInterface 等。

于 2020-07-10T12:48:38.537 回答